              I went home after my walk and research how beach foam forms ....
The bubbles and foam you see are the results of many things.  Animals die in the oceans and as their bodies decompose some elements and oils are released.  They take time to be reabsorbed and that is part of the substance.  Plant life -- some of it  too small to see and some of it from decomposing plants add to the mix. 

                        EWWWWWWWW!


Each of these things contributes to the film which captures the bubbles as the waves break near the shore and hold the bubbles for a bit as foam.  The more foam, the more the contamination of the water.  Clean sea water should have almost no foam and the bubbles should break almost immediately as they wash up on shore.
